推荐一款强大的iOS表情键盘库——ISEmojiView
去发现同类优质开源项目:https://gitcode.com/
如果你正在为你的iOS应用寻找一个易于使用的表情键盘,那么请关注这个开源项目——ISEmojiView,它是一个完全由Swift编写的高效且可定制的表情键盘解决方案。
项目介绍
ISEmojiView是一个模仿iOS系统表情键盘的库,提供丰富的功能和高度自定义的可能性。它的设计简洁而直观,能够无缝集成到你的应用中,为用户提供快速输入表情的能力。包括最近常用表情、多种肤色表情支持以及底部类别切换栏等特性,都能让你的应用体验更加接近原生。
项目技术分析
- Swift语言编写:整个库基于最新的Swift版本构建,确保了良好的性能和代码质量。
- 自定义表情支持:除了内置的标准表情外,还允许添加和管理自定义表情。
- 多种皮肤色调:支持从浅色到深色的六种肤色表情符号,与现代社交应用保持一致。
- 底部栏切换:用户可以方便地在不同类别之间切换,如同iOS系统的原生表情键盘。
- 夜间模式兼容:黑暗主题的支持,使得在暗光环境下使用更为舒适。
- SwiftUI支持:对于使用SwiftUI进行界面开发的开发者,此库同样提供了适配。
应用场景
无论是在聊天应用、社交媒体应用,还是任何需要用户输入情感表达的地方,ISEmojiView都能成为提升用户体验的重要工具。通过简单的API调用,你可以将它设置为文本输入框的输入视图,让用户在输入文字的同时轻松插入表情。
项目特点
- 易用性:只需要几行代码即可实现集成,提供了详尽的示例代码和文档说明。
- 跨平台:支持CocoaPods、Carthage和Swift Package Manager三种安装方式。
- 高度自定义:允许调整键盘布局、颜色甚至添加自定义表情,满足个性化需求。
- 响应式:长按弹出预览效果,与iOS10系统键盘体验一致。
为了尝试和了解更多信息,你可以直接运行项目中的示例应用,或者通过阅读项目文档来开始集成到你的项目中。
总之,ISEmojiView是一款强大、灵活且易于使用的表情键盘库,它能为你的iOS应用增添丰富的情感表达元素,提高用户的交互体验。赶紧试试看吧!
去发现同类优质开源项目:https://gitcode.com/